cg annotate(1)

Från Wiki.linux.se
Hoppa till navigering Hoppa till sök

cg_annotate(1) - Linux manual sida

NAMN

cg_annotate - Efterbearbetningsverktyg för Cachegrind

SYNOPSIS

cg_annotate [<alternativ>] <cachegrind-utdatafil> [<källfiler>...]

BESKRIVNING

cg_annotate tar en eller flera Cachegrind-utdatafiler och skriver ut data om det profilerade programmet i ett lättläst format.

ALTERNATIV

  • -h --help
 Visar hjälpmeddelandet.
  • --version
 Visar versionsnumret.
  • --diff
 Jämför två Cachegrind-utdatafiler.
  • --mod-filename <regex> [standard: ingen]
 Anger ett s/gammalt/nytt/ sök-och-ersätt-uttryck som används på alla filnamn. Användbart vid jämförelser för att eliminera små skillnader i sökvägar mellan två versioner av ett program som ligger i olika kataloger. Ett i-suffix gör regexen skiftlägesokänslig och ett g-suffix gör att det matchar flera gånger.
  • --mod-funcname <regex> [standard: ingen]
 Liknar --mod-filename, men för funktionsnamn. Användbart för att eliminera små skillnader i slumpmässigt genererade funktionsnamn av vissa kompilatorer.
  • --show=A,B,C [standard: alla, i ordningen i Cachegrind-utdatafilen]
 Anger vilka händelser som ska visas (och kolumnordning). Standard är att använda alla händelser i Cachegrind-utdatafilen i den ordning de finns där. Bäst att använda tillsammans med --sort.
  • --sort=A,B,C [standard: ordningen i Cachegrind-utdatafilen]
 Anger de händelser som används som sorteringsgrund för fil:funktion- och funktion:fil-listorna.
  • --threshold=X [standard: 0,1 %]
 Anger signifikansgränsen för fil:funktion- och funktion:fil-sektionerna. En fil eller funktion visas om den står för mer än X% av räkningarna för den primära sorteringshändelsen. Om källfiler annoteras påverkar detta också vilka filer som annoteras.
  • --show-percs, --no-show-percs, --show-percs=<no|yes> [standard: yes]
 När aktiverat visas en procentuell andel bredvid alla händelseräknare. Detta hjälper till att bedöma den relativa vikten av varje funktion och rad.
  • --annotate, --no-annotate, --annotate=<no|yes> [standard: yes]
 Aktiverar eller inaktiverar annotering av källfiler.
  • --context=N [standard: 8]
 Antal rader av sammanhang att visa före och efter varje annoterad rad. Använd ett stort tal (t.ex. 100000) för att visa alla källrader.

SE ÄVEN

FÖRFATTARE

Nicholas Nethercote.

KOLOFON

Denna sida är en del av Valgrind-projektet, ett system för felsökning och profilering av Linux-program. Mer information om projektet finns på valgrind.org.

Buggrapporter för denna manual kan lämnas på valgrind.org/support/bug_reports.html. Denna sida hämtades från projektets uppströms-Git-repository [http://sourceware.org/git/valgrind

Sidslut

Orginalhemsidan på Engelska :https://man7.org/linux/man-pages/man1/cg_annotate.1.html


Det här är en maskinöversättning av Linux man sidor till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på https://www.linux.se/kontaka-linux-se/

Tack till Datorhjälp som har sponsrat Linux.se med webbhotell.